French scoff at apartment with “perceived square meters”

2023-01-31T14:35:39.316Z


Not 12 square meters, but feels like 16 - that's how a mini apartment in Paris is advertised. Mockers are now also thinking about "perceived" rents.

A real estate advertisement for a mini-apartment in Paris, which inflated the size a bit by saying "perceived square meters" caused mocking comments in France.

"The real estate agents in Paris no longer know what to think up," wrote a user on social media about the advertisement, in which the 11.53 square meter apartment, minus sloping ceilings and stairs, was advertised as "felt 16 square meters". will.

"Answer that you are willing to pay rent of 100 euros - felt like 1000 euros," wrote another user, as reported by the broadcaster BFMTV on Tuesday.

"It's a 12 square meter apartment by law but we put mirrors on all the walls so it really feels like 70-75 square meters if you sit in the middle, don't worry," suggested a third.

Another commented on the fundamental problem of the very small and expensive apartments in the French capital: »Paris is really crazy, for renting a bad room in Paris you pay for a nice apartment or a house in the provinces, I understand them Not people who dream of living in Paris.«
